Two Weeks of Prednisolone Was as Effective as Four Weeks in Improving Carpal Tunnel Syndrome Symptoms.

Abstract
- Studies the long-term effectiveness of oral steroids given for 2 weeks compared with 4 weeks in patients with carpal tunnel syndrome (CTS). Prednisolone for 2 weeks versus 4 weeks for CTS at 12 months; Relative benefit reduction among patients.
